I made a reservation early one morning based on a recommendation from another kennel. Later that day we drove to the business to check it out. It was extremely noisy and the staff were non-responsive and apathetic. We cancelled our reservation the same day but they refused to give us a refund. There are much better choices in the Houston area. We remember this client and this representation of what happened is not factual. The client booked a reservation over the phone and it was within our 5-day cancellation policy and it was for a holiday stay when we typically fill up and have to turn other clients away. At the time of the booking, the client was advised that the booking was within the 5-day window and that a refund would not be made if the booking was later canceled. The client did come in later that day to tour the facility and left without comment or complaint of any kind after the tour. The client never showed up for the reservation so it was canceled late in the evening (after closing time) on the day the client was to drop off for the stay. It would not have appropriate to refund the deposit since the client was advised at the time of booking that the deposit was non-refundable since the reservation was within the 5-day booking window coupled with the fact that the client toured the facility without comment and then never called to cancel the reservation.
